Full Job Description PC/Network Technician Department:
IT Reports to:
IT Manager Salary:
$29.08•$36.14 per hour Summary Recommend, evaluate, test, obtain quotes, order, receive and install PC/Network hardware and software. Perform PC/Network hardware and software system upgrades. Provide PC/Network help desk functions, including user assistance, troubleshooting, resolving and training. Troubleshoot and coordinate resolutions to PC/Network systems problems. Coordinate repairs of company printers. Assist Network Administrator with maintaining hardware and software for network, telephony system, and network administration activities.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Evaluate, test, recommend, obtain quotes, order and install PC/Network hardware and/or software. Perform PC/Network hardware and software system upgrades. Recommend, evaluate, test, order, and install PC/Network printers. Performs software, firmware and hardware systems upgrades and coordinates printer repairs with outside vendor. Troubleshoot and coordinate the resolution of PC/Network and printer system problems. Provide PC/Network help desk functions including user assistance and training. Enter tracking tickets for all issues, problems, and resolutions turned into Help Desk function. Perform daily tape backups of servers and maintain offsite tape schedule. Assist Network Administrator with maintaining network including things like adding or replacing wiring and/or network cards. Ensure software registration and compliance with license software agreements. Conduct research on hardware and software upgrades. Maintain PC hardware and software inventory records. Coordinate work with outside vendors. Backup for Network/Telecom Administrator as needed. Keep up knowledge about PC/Network security threats and trends. Utilize virus, spamware and malware software to remove security threats from PC/Network. Perform other duties as assigned. knowledge, skills and abilities Must be computer literate and have familiarity with Microsoft Office Products. Understanding of current networking knowledge and familiarity with Window's Operating Systems and Microsoft Exchange is required. Must be able to lift up to 70 lbs and climb ladders up to 10 ft tall. Good with problem solving and the ability to troubleshoot, prioritize and resolve PC/Network hardware, software and printer problems.

WORK ENVIRONMENT
Usual office working conditions with moderate noise such as computers and printers, telephones and copy machines. Minimum qualifications An Associates degree in a related field plus a minimum of 2 years of related training and experience or any equivalent combination of training and experience. MCP and Network+ certification beneficial.
